#! /usr/bin/env bash # This is a simple wrapper for pacman to install packages at userspace. # Everytime you execute this wrapper it will create ~/.local/var/pkglist. # This dir is need to dump files which package is installed and which files are extracted to ~/.local/ # With the -i argument you install packages like: # $ u8-pacman -i zola # This will download zola from the repository and pipe the tar.zst to extract the files into ~/.local/ # also all exracted files will be documented at ~/.local/var/pkglist/zola.lst # This wrapper need this file, to list installed packages, update all packages or remove the files. # # With the -l option you list all packages which are installed via this wrapper by list all files from ~/.local/bin/var/pkglist/ # # The remove option -r $PACKAGENME will read the extracted files from ~/.local/bin/var/pkglist/$PACKAGENAME.lst and remove all this files. # Also it will remove it self # # The -u option will read all ~/.local/bin/var/pkglist/*.lst files to gether the installed packages and reinstall them with the current package from the repository.
